Output a296b1e691be5f8be750d0186efa5b626354b625874078fd512e16aae7c22af8:54

value
158314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f765398a6e876640d6fe0c6161e74da1e8a27759 OP_EQUAL
address
3QF869RgzAfsWwxDjMPS13ZTMpXoeyBDjn
transaction
a296b1e691be5f8be750d0186efa5b626354b625874078fd512e16aae7c22af8
spent
true